Justin Vivian Bond Instagram – Last night at Carnegie Hall I had the delightful privilege of honoring Candy Darling on the eve of Trans Day of Remembrance by singing The Velvet Underground song “Candy Says.”

The evening was in celebration of Music and Revolution: Greenwich Village in the 60s by @richardbarone. If you had told me I would one day sing in Zankel Hall on the same stage with @josefeliciano, @paxton_tom, members of The Feelies, The Bongos, Carolyn Hester, @ericandersenofficial, and @davidjohansen.official I would have thought you were crazy!!!

These people changed the world!

There were beautiful performances by @jennimuldaur and her dad Geoff, Marshall Crenshaw, Vernon Reid, Lennie Kay, Willie Nile, Mary Lee Kortes, @terre_roche, David Amram, and a slew of others. The BAND were a joy to sing with. I was very happy to be performing with my friend @joemcginty7 again, what a treasure.

I felt out of place and intimidated when I first arrived but they were all so warm and welcoming I soon relaxed and had a wonderful time while learning a lot and being deeply moved.

Evidently folk singers live a long time. If you want to stick around awhile get out those guitars, kids!

I can’t wait for the release of the new Candy Darling movie starring @harinef.

Also, get ready for a fantastic biography by C. Carr coming on in 2024.
